Jennifer Hoag Maynes was the recipient of the Chapter President's Award this summer. Click "read more" to read below for her thoughts on the entire Level One experience. Jennifer Hoag Maynes: I was very excited for Level 1 Orff. Until I went to class. And then I was scared and felt completely out of my league and wanted to drop the course. I was really that scared. I went to school and came home and did homework. Eventually Week 1 was finished and I was starting to feel more myself again. Week 2 was much better. I decided to stop being scared and feeling inadequate all the time. I asked for help when I needed it and started to enjoy myself. It was a good decision I made. I enjoyed the second week much more than the first. From this class, I will take with me greater confidence! I have a great list of reference books (pedagogy, practise, picture books) and have great people who make me feel like I am on a team, since being a music teacher is a bit lonely sometimes. I bring a desire to incorporate more creative movement into my classroom and a goal to create my own ‘Orff piece’ and have my students try it out!
